Transaction 79deebe4f14f5e32157c32cce45a223895be787b18ded1254390c8a160c138a8
1 Input
1 Output
-
79deebe4f14f5e32157c32cce45a223895be787b18ded1254390c8a160c138a8:0
- value
- 61574106
- script pubkey
- OP_0 OP_PUSHBYTES_20 edd712816387ea15b78b6de30ca7844e394a86e6
- address
- bc1qaht39qtrsl4ptdutdh3sefuyfcu54phx6edsq4